Does anyone know of a way to use the IH to record a push button response (like a number), rather than recording callers voice responses.

No - you can't do that. The record is specific to audio, not TT events - those get acted on up stream (i.e. they terminate the recording) and it moves on to the next state. There is no provision there for "recording" TTs.

Is there a way to make this happen at all using Unity?

Currently there's no mechanism to record a series of TTS as a message. There are conversations that collect TTs (i.e. for changing your transfer number over the phone) but these are special conversations that store TT strings based on TT events and store the resulting string. There's no way to save TT entries as a message for a subscriber or DL or the like at this point.

Is there a way to make the IH initiate calls to people, like some of those surveys do? Also, there is probably no way to know where the call came from?

No - Unity is not designed to do canvasing type calls like that. The only notification capabilities Unity has is notifying subscribers of messages of various types - it will call (or page or email or SMS) those subscribers and they can log into their mailbox to get the messages - that's the only callout capabilities in the product.
